FAQ: The Nitty-Gritty of Real Money Slots

What does “UKGC licensed” actually mean for me?

It means the site is regulated by the UK Gambling Commission. They enforce strict rules on fair play, responsible gambling, and data protection. You have a legal route for complaints. It’s not a guarantee of a win, but it’s a guarantee you won’t get cheated on the RTP. All the sites I listed hold a valid UKGC license.

Can I withdraw my winnings instantly?

From what I’ve seen, e-wallets (PayPal, Skrill, Neteller) are the fastest. Usually 1-2 hours. Bank transfers take 2-5 days. Debit cards (Visa, Mastercard) are in the middle, around 24 hours. Sites like Bet365 and LeoVegas are known for quick payouts. If a site takes longer than 48 hours for an e-wallet withdrawal, I’d question their license.
